Shipping duration varies depending on:
- Warehouse location
- Carrier service used (Standard vs Express)
- Seasonal demand
Typical delivery timeframes for Canadian buyers are:
Shipping TypeEstimated DeliveryStandard Shipping7–14 business daysExpedited/Express3–7 business daysRemote areas (Northern territories, rural regions)14–20+ business days
Note: Major cities like Toronto, Vancouver, Calgary, and Montreal usually receive deliveries faster than more remote locations such as Nunavut or Yukon.

Canada Border Services Agency (CBSA) may charge duties or taxes if:
- The package value is above the duty-free limit
- The item ships from outside of Canada
- The carrier processes the package through customs inspection
However, many phone case orders fall beneath taxable thresholds, so most Canadian buyers receive their cases without extra fees. Always check the store’s policy to see if duties are prepaid or if customs might apply upon arrival.

A buyer-friendly return policy should include:
- Clear return window (e.g., 14–30 days)
- Refund or exchange options
- Instructions on how to ship the item back
- Clarification on who covers return shipping costs
With accessories like phone cases, returns are usually accepted if:
- The product is unused
- It is in original packaging
- There are manufacturing defects or wrong items delivered
Because phone accessories are personal use items, some companies may not accept returns once opened. Always double-check before ordering.
